What it costs to own in Forest Lakes

On a median-priced Forest Lakes home ($260,000), property taxes at Palm Beach County’s typical millage of 18.7191 run roughly $3,931 a year with the homestead exemption applied — before any CDD or special-district charges, which vary by community.

The average Citizens Property Insurance premium in Palm Beach County is about $1,753 a year (April 2026 filings); private-market quotes differ, and a good agent will tell you which carriers are actually writing here.

Run the real numbers before you commit: what selling nets you, whether your Save Our Homes benefit moves with you, and rent vs buy in Palm Beach County.

At Forest Lakes’s $260,000 median and Palm Beach County’s adopted 18.72 mills (FY2025-26), a home assessed at that price carries roughly $4,870 a year in property tax before exemptions, or about $4,090 with the full Florida homestead exemption — a buyer’s first-year figure; a long-time owner’s Save Our Homes cap can be far lower, which is one reason resale taxes jump at closing. Municipal and special-district millage varies inside the county; see the Palm Beach County tax page.

Rents and the investor math

Typical asking rent across Palm Beach County sits near $2,648 a month (Zillow’s rent index). Rents are moving about 2.9% year over year. County-level yield math pencils to roughly a 6.69% cap rate on typical numbers, before expenses. Home prices run about 5.85x the county’s median household income, the affordability backdrop every buyer here negotiates inside. If you are weighing an investment purchase in Forest Lakes, ask your agent for community-level rent comps rather than county averages — the spread between communities is wide.

Who is moving to Palm Beach County, and what they earn

The county lost a net 1,374 people in the latest IRS county-migration year. Households moving IN average $177,212 in income versus $98,618 for those moving out — movers arriving here earn more than those leaving, which shapes what sellers can ask and what buyers compete against. The biggest out-of-state feeder markets are NY, NJ, MA. Median household income in Palm Beach County has grown about 35% since 2018 ($81,115 now). Population is up about 4% over the same stretch. An agent who knows these flows can tell you which way demand in Forest Lakes is actually pointing, not just where prices have been.

Sources: IRS SOI county-to-county migration; U.S. Census income and population estimates. County-level data for context; community demand varies within the county.

If you’re buying in Forest Lakes

Time is on your side in Forest Lakes right now. Tour aggressively, compare concessions — rate buydowns and credits often beat a small price cut — and let your agent use days-on-market as negotiating leverage. Every price cut on a listing is information.

If you’re selling in Forest Lakes

Selling into a slower Forest Lakes market means prep and pricing are the whole game. Interview agents on their marketing reach beyond the MLS, their plan for the first 14 days, and what they would do at day 45 if showings stall. The wrong list price costs more than any commission difference.

How much are property taxes in Forest Lakes?
Using the Palm Beach County FY2025-26 rate of 18.72 mills and Forest Lakes's recorded median sold price of $260,000, a home assessed at that price would owe roughly $4,870 a year before exemptions, or about $4,090 with the full homestead exemption. Long-time owners under Save Our Homes usually pay less; taxes reset toward this level when a home sells. Actual bills depend on the parcel's municipality and special districts.
